Judging from the media released so far, the game seems to be running very smoothly, relying on the power of Unreal Engine 3. The environments appear crammed with enough detail such as dense jungle foliage (most of which can be used for hiding) with animated grass, which the players may use as cover. Moreover, M-rated elements are also in there, so you may see a fair amount of blood and gore in the game. For example, if a dinosaur is standing too close to a detonated grenade, blood splatters all over the place, as the blast tears the poor creature limb from limb.

For what it's worth, Propaganda Games are making an effort to bring a worthy new addition to the franchise. With the prospects of engaging gameplay mechanics, combining stealth and action, Turok could easily wind up among some of the most popular FPS titles. To make things even more interesting for gamers, the developers also promised a multiplayer mode that supports up to 16 players. Recent reports indicated that the multiplayer will be online only and will sport 10 maps, 7 of which have been designed for competitive play (Deathmatch, Team Deathmatch, CTF, etc.) and 3 for co-op. By the way, co-op levels were designed specifically for 4-player co-op play and were said to be more than a mere rehash of the single-player campaign. We'll see how that works. Naturally, the online multiplayer will be playable via PlayStation Network and Xbox Live.
